When i turn on the

F5 - E1 Self clean latch will not lock

1. If door latched:
  1. Disconnect power from unit.
  2. Check wires and connectors from control to door switch, then from door switch to control. If no damage to wires and all connectors okay, proceed to step C.
  3. Replace door switch.
  4. Re-apply power.
  5. Press and hold any key down for 1 minute to clear F5 failure code from memory. F2 will appear. Press CANCEL and observe for 1 minute to ensure operation is correct.
2. If door not latched:
  1. Disconnect power from unit.
  2. Check wires and connectors from control to latch switch, then from latch switch to control. If no damage to wires and all connectors okay, proceed to step C.
  3. Repeat steps A and B for door switch.
3. Measure door switch (door open = switch open small low voltage terminals). Replace switch if defective.
4. Measure latch switch (unlatch = switch open, CAUTION - oven light contacts are closed). Replace switch if defective.
5. If corrections are made in any step, reconnect power to control. Press and hold any key for 1 minute to clear R failure code from memory. F2 will appear. Press CANCEL and observe for 1 minute to ensure operation is correct.
6. If failure remains, disconnect power and replace control.

I set the oven to

If the top burners work the the DSI control is fine. Check your oven distribution valve. It should read 216 ohms between any of the 3 terminals. If it is open between any 2 then you have a bad distribution valve.

After setting my oven to

This is likely the oven temperature sensor needs replacing (step 3) But if that checks good follow steps 1 and 2 .The videos will walk you thru performing the checks.

1. Look for welded relay contacts on bake or broil relays. If this happens, replace oven control (also called clock or ERC).
2. For SELF CLEAN models: check door lock operation.
3. Look for a high resistance connection or any other cause of high resistance in the oven temperature sensor circuit. Check sensor, sensor harness and sensor harness connection at sensor and oven control. Replace sensor if found defective.

The range displays f5 e1 when i try to run

The E1- F5 error is a door lock error.

The control (TIMER) has likely failed in this instance - BUT...

Sometimes when you disconnect power to a range and reconnect it the electronic range control gets confused.
You should disconnect power again for 15 seconds and reconnect and see if that helps.

If it doesn't cure the E1- F5 error hold the bake button in until E0- F2 appears in the display.
This is the error for a stuck button on the keypad and is the way to clear the memory of the electronic range control.

Sometimes these work, but if the control has failed it won't make any difference.

I have a whirlpool super capacity 465 electric

F1-E1 - EEPROM Checksum Error - Disconnect power for at least 30 seconds and then reconnect.
Allow at least a minute after power has been restored and if error code reappears, replace control board (clock).

My gas oven, Super Capacity

Hello there
Please read the entire solution i have provided below ok
It won't bake or broil If neither the oven nor the broiler heats, but the range burners still work, the clock may be set for a timed or self-cleaning cycle. Check to be sure the clock buttons and knobs are set properly. If your clock has a knob that says "push for man(ual)," push the knob in and try heating the oven and broiler again. If they still don't work properly, you probably have a defect in the thermostat, selector switch, or common wiring. Note... If the oven doesn't have a separate bake/broil/etc. selector switch, the problem is often with the thermostat. It's not easy to check the selector switch or thermostat for proper operation. If you suspect a problem with either of these, call a qualified appliance repair technician.

Gas range does not heat

If it is just the oven not heating, this is generally cause by a bad ignitor. These newer ranges do not use a pilot light. Instead they use an ignitor, and this is the problem 95% of the time. To be for sure I would need some more intel which would require taking a few things apart.

But If the range is in good condition and fairly new, I would repair it as long as the repair man isn't to expensive :) Ignitors usually cost around $50 - $90 dollars. It depends on if the repair man uses an ignitor just like the one that is in the range, or an aftermarket which works just fine but is cheaper in price. good luck to you!
